Sale Prices on Crescent Court, Father Griffin Rd
11 recorded sales on Crescent Court in Father Griffin Rd, County Galway, 17 Dec 2014 to 15 Apr 2026. Median sale price €290,000.
€290,000median sale price
€200,000lowest
€445,000highest
11sales
By year
| Year | Sales | Median |
|---|---|---|
| 2014 | 1 | €217,000 |
| 2015 | 2 | €215,000 |
| 2017 | 2 | €227,500 |
| 2018 | 1 | €295,000 |
| 2021 | 1 | €290,000 |
| 2022 | 1 | €360,000 |
| 2023 | 1 | €370,000 |
| 2025 | 1 | €445,000 |
| 2026 | 1 | €400,000 |
